Default Full screen issues (1920x1080 resolution)

Oftentimes when I put the game into full screen (my preference), if I click anywhere in the extremities of the screen, the game will go back into windowed mode. This is pretty annoying, but not sure if there is a fix for it. I think it may just be a case of my comp being too new for the software (I have an nvidia 560ti gtx).

If anyone has a fix, please let me know.

Otherwise, does anyone know how to blacken the area around the window?

What he means is that when you are in windowed mode, make the resolution the same as you would in full screen and then drag the windowed mode window to cover as much of the screen as you can manage. Then switch back to full screen mode. When you are back in full screen mode the "click through" effect will only happen where your windowed mode screen doesn't cover.

Guys, I play full screen all the time at 1920x1200 and 1920x1080.

You have to move the option windows to the center of your screen, including the yes/no dialog box.

You'll be able to click them without being thrown back into windowed mode, if you position it just right.

I had the same problem on both my laptop and desktop. I would log on click and it would minimize. Once I clicked back on everquest it would be in windowed mode. To solve it I would go to options in game. Click resolution and set it to the same resolution as my desktop. Even though in game everquest said I was running at 1920x1200 which is the same as my desktop resolution I would click on it again and hit apply. Once I applied the resolution again instead of hitting alt enter to make it full screen. I would hit options in game and click full screen, and those two simple steps has solved that problem for me on both my computers. So in other words when you log in set your resolution again and hit apply even though it shows you are at the right resolution. Also sometimes everquest would minimize and close randomly. I have fixed that problem by setting my fps to 50 instead of 100, which can be done in options as well. As weird as it sounds that works perfectly for me and I use a gtx 580 graphics card.
